College Gameday & SEC Basketball Open Thread
Rupp Arena is supposedly sold out at 24,000+ for both tonight's game, and this morning's live College Gameday on ESPN. The show will air live from Rupp at 11:00 AM and again at 8:00 PM, and John Calipari and John Wall are scheduled to be on set.
The Vols and Cats are the only Top 25 matchup in college basketball today, but five SEC matchups and a big non-conference opportunity for Florida highlight today's schedule:
- LSU at #24 Vanderbilt - 1:30 PM - SEC Network
- Arkansas at Alabama - 4:00 PM - SEC Network
- South Carolina at Georgia - 4:00 PM - SEC Network
- Xavier at Florida - 6:00 PM - ESPN
- Auburn at Mississippi State - 7:00 PM - Fox Sports South
- #12 Tennessee at #2 Kentucky - 9:00 PM - ESPN
